Parade College – Rivergum Theatre

12K Lumens of Laser Brightness for Rivergum Theatre

  • Parade College

  • July 2018

  • Epson EB-L1505UHNL 12,000 ANSI Lumens 4K Projector, Epson ELPLW06 Wide Throw Lens, Epson ELPLM15 Standard Throw Lens, Crestron Control System inc. 1x DMPS3-4K-150-C 3-Series 4K DigitalMedia Presentation System 100, 2x TSW-560 5” Touch Screens, 2x DM-TX-4K-100-C-1G Wall Plate 4K DigitalMedia Transmitters, 1x C2N-IO Control Port Expansion Module, Blackmagic Design Mini Analogue to SDI Converter with SDI Cable

Parade College is a Catholic all-boys multi-campus secondary school, run under the auspices of the Congregation of Christian Brothers and Edmund Rice Education Australia.

Parade College’s Bundoora Campus (at 1436 Plenty Road) reached out to Vision One‘s installation team to commission a new projection and Crestron control system in their Rivergum Theatre.

We decommissioned an existing low-brightness projector and substituted this unit for a new Epson EB-L1505UHNL WUXGA with 4K Enhancement Laser Projector. Powered by 3LCD technology and Epson’s laser optical engine, the EB-L1505UNL is capable of producing White Light and Colour Light Output of up to 12,000 lumens in WUXGA resolution, delivering captivating images in virtually any venue.

The laser light source also lets you take control of brightness with precise adjustment in increments of 1% and a constant brightness mode that maintains brightness at a specified level to match any venue or subject.

The projector was installed with an ELPLM15 Middle Throw Lens to fit the existing 6m wide motorised projection screen. An ELPLW06 Wide Throw Lens was also supplied to deliver breathtaking 13m wide image and video backdrops for school productions.

The existing CommBox infrastructure was restored and upgraded to a fully-automated Crestron Control System that included a DMPS 3-Series Presentation Switcher, white and black 5″ Touch Screens and HDBaseT Powered Wall Plates and Control Modules.

The school required the re-use of existing video composite equipment, so we provided a Blackmagic Mini Analogue to SDI Converter, transforming this analogue signal into compatible SDI cabling.
